Campus mental health support for students during finals

With finals week quickly approaching, a time when stress typically runs high, it’s important to know where and how to refer students to the support they need. Below are resources from UHS that instructors can share:

For students feeling anxious about exams:
Thrive Online offers practical tools, strategies, and worksheets across three learning modules: Test Anxiety, Stress Management, and Procrastination.

For students with small concerns who would benefit from a brief conversation with a professional:
Let’s Talk provides 20-minute drop-in consultations with a UHS mental health provider at locations across campus.

For students with ongoing concerns who want to speak to a licensed professional quickly:
Uwill offers virtual counseling every day, including evenings and weekends, with appointments typically available within 24 hours.

For students experiencing a mental health crisis:
Call the 24/7 Mental Health Crisis Support Line at 608-265-5600 (option 9).
